The thing about 50 is he's totally unconvincing and uses the same tone of voice, same one emotion for every scene, but the character he's playing in this isn't convincing either and his decisions didn't make sense from one scene to the next. The whole thing didn't make sense in fact. Even his girlfriend and his cougar pal Dana Delany didn't make sense. His buddy the white cop, what the hell was he doing suddenly shooting two guys about halfway through? Another character that didn't make sense and seemed to change out of the blue. And after that De Niro gives 50 shit for the killings and makes him snort coke, which was a another plot dead end. And what was De Niro doing in this anyway, playing a cliche caricature who was totally one dimensional? I dunno what the hell Forest Whitaker's character was doing either. There were too many random scenes that went nowhere, like the film maker just wanted to film a scene like this and a scene like that and when Vinnie Jones manages to out-act everyone in the room you know you've got big problems. I could go on for ages pointing out the stupidity of the film. I suppose I got some entertainment value out of it, I just can't think what it is right now...
